Publisher's summary

Camilla Hearst is a Harlot.

God forgives little girls who don’t obey, but he forsakes women who surrender their bodies to desires of the flesh.

Raised to believe her very existence was a sin, Camilla escaped her father’s iron fist and chased the sun to Grand Haven, California, where one thing was for certain:

It’s a man’s world.

She was prepared to live in it until the day Camilla met the highest paid escort in the city - exposing an underground world where women rule like queens. Now Camilla finds herself offering her body to the highest bidder.

Falling for Grand Haven’s golden-boy and mafia attorney, Wilder Ridge, only strengthens her desire to break free from her dark past and control her own destiny. But in a society where everything has a price tag, she discovers her body isn't the only thing for sale.

So is her life.

Harlot was another easy five star read for me. This is book two of the Hush series. It takes place two years after the events in Hush.
Camilla was labeled a harlot and a sinner at six years old by her crazy dad and her terrified mom. After turning 18 years old, she got as far away from them as she could. She wound up being a professional harlot working for Hush, living with the owner, Lydia Montgomery and pining after Wilder Ridge. She embraces her job and her new “found family". As her and Wilder develop a relationship, the Maria’s involvement gets more intense. Someone else wants Camilla and he always gets what he wants.
This was an angst-filled, action-packed novel woven with heartbreaking memories that had my chest getting tight. The chemistry and heat between individuals in both couples was intense and envious. I wish there was another Ridge brother I could claim but then again, I’d love to claim Wilder! I’m really looking forward to Criminal that’s kindly waiting on my kindle. I listened to this audiobook and the narrator did a top-notch job. If dark, alpha men with strong as hell women are your thing, I highly recommend this series. Very mixed feelings

I enjoyed Tramp a good bit, and let’s get real here- I bought Harlot for the cover. The story did have some solid points, but for me, they kind of got lost in the nonsense. There was just way too much going on in this book. Camilla’s backstory, how she was portrayed, the whole mafia thing, the supposed deal with the Coppola’s. It got ridiculous. I think this series would’ve been better if it was focused entirely on Hush or entirely on the mafia because neither aspect seemed fully fleshed out IMO. It felt contrived. I did enjoy the chemistry between Camilla & Wilder and will definitely be checking out more of Mary Elizabeth’s books. ***One caveat I’d like to add is that I am NOT meaning this as a dismissal of Camilla’s backstory. If, for example, you’ve read about Flame from Tillie Cole’s Hades Hangmen series, you’ll know that his upbringing fit his story & character. Camilla’s, at least in my experience while reading, didn’t fit at all.
